"Enough staff to meet needs and a positive team culture, but managers missed safety risks like hot radiators and open windows."
Per 2020 comprehensive inspection: We identified a lack of risk assessment and management monitoring in relation to the risk of burns and scalds from hot surfaces such as unguarded radiators and the risk of falls from unrestricted windows.
Per 2020 comprehensive inspection: Staff told us they liked working at Brewery House. 'I really like working here. It is calm and we see the difference we make to people's lives.' 'We work well as a team'
Per 2020 comprehensive inspection: There were enough staff available to meet people's needs during our inspection. Staffing levels were based on individual needs.
Per 2020 comprehensive inspection: Staff had access to relevant training, regular supervision and annual appraisal. Whilst some staff said formal supervisions were not always planned and as regular as they would like.
Per 2020 comprehensive inspection: Provider auditing processes needed to be more robust as they had not identified the risk areas prior to this inspection.
Per 2020 comprehensive inspection: People were supported to take part in a wide range of activities they were interested in such as drama groups, shopping, holidays and access to entertainment of their choice.
